Output 2368299a83a7e27b29a60f300c49d810debc213d02d0cd55ad4743d4cc0311fb:0

value
882660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acb54c5521870dd8b49b09a9e23ed571ac7cffe9 OP_EQUAL
address
3HSDLMdhH9k7HvHnvz72wWuYFuBRRdyViq
transaction
2368299a83a7e27b29a60f300c49d810debc213d02d0cd55ad4743d4cc0311fb
spent
true